Abstract
Laser surface treatment was used to enhance the corrosion resistance of a high nickel austenitic ductile iron in 0.1% hydrochloric acid solution. After laser treatment, the corrosion potential of the high nickel austenitic ductile iron increased to a more noble level and the corrosion current considerably decreased. This is believed due to a refinement of the coarse ledeburite eutectic at or near the austenitic grain boundary and elimination of the graphite spheroids in laser modified layer.
